117.info
人生若只如初见

正则表达式空格如何匹配

正则表达式中,空格可以使用`\s`匹配。`\s`匹配任意空白字符,包括空格、制表符、换行符等。

举个例子,如果想要匹配一个包含空格的字符串,可以使用以下正则表达式:

```
\s+
```

上面的正则表达式可以匹配一个或多个连续的空格字符。如果只想匹配一个空格,可以使用以下正则表达式:

```
\s
```

如果只想匹配一个空格或一个制表符,可以使用以下正则表达式:

```
[ \t]
```

上面的正则表达式使用了字符类`[]`来匹配一个空格或一个制表符。其中`\t`表示制表符。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e1a8AzsLBANUA1E.html

推荐文章

  • 正则表达式替换指定字符串的方法是什么

    正则表达式替换指定字符串的方法是使用sub()函数。sub()函数用于替换字符串中匹配正则表达式的部分。
    语法如下:
    re.sub(pattern, repl, string, coun...

  • 常用的正则表达式测试工具有哪些

    常用的正则表达式测试工具有: 正则表达式测试器(Regex Tester):是一个在线的正则表达式测试工具,可以输入要匹配的文本和正则表达式,实时查看匹配结果。 Re...

  • 正则表达式常用语法解析

    正则表达式是一种用于匹配字符串模式的工具,它用一种描述性的语言来定义搜索模式。常用的正则表达式语法包括: 字符匹配:使用普通字符直接匹配文本的字符,例如...

  • 求一个只允许输入数字的正则表达式

    只允许输入数字的正则表达式可以使用如下表达式:
    ^[0-9]+$
    解释:
    ^ 表示以什么开头
    [0-9] 表示匹配数字0-9之间的任意一个字符 表示匹配前...

  • 人工智能目前存在的问题有哪些

    人工智能目前存在的问题有以下几个方面:1. 数据偏见:人工智能的算法和模型是通过大量的数据训练得出的,但如果训练数据存在偏见,那么模型也会反映出这些偏见。...

  • 人工智能技术的发展趋势是什么

    人工智能技术的发展趋势包括以下几个方面:1. 深度学习和神经网络:深度学习和神经网络是当前人工智能领域的热点技术,它们通过模仿人类神经系统的方式,实现了在...

  • spring的核心配置文件是什么

    在Spring框架中,核心的配置文件通常是一个XML文件,命名为applicationContext.xml。该文件包含了Spring容器的配置信息,用于定义和配置Spring的各种组件,如bea...

  • mysql分页查询优化的方法是什么

    MySQL分页查询的优化方法包括:1. 使用索引:在进行分页查询时,使用合适的索引可以大大提高查询性能。可以创建适当的索引,以确保查询中使用的列能够被快速定位...